Things You'll Need:
- Phillips screwdriver
-
Step 1
Shut off the power and unplug the vacuum from the electrical outlet.
-
Step 2
Lay the vacuum cleaner on the floor so the bottom of the nozzle is accessible.
-
Step 3
Unscrew the three screws from the bottom plate. Two of the screws are located on the right side of the bottom plate, and the other is on the left.
-
Step 4
Lift the back of the bottom plate and pull it off the nozzle to remove it.
